    I've carried both a FF and a crop body for a number of years and have owned and used almost every 1 series body (1D, 1Ds, 1D2, 1D2n, 1D2s and briefly a 1D3 which I returned due to the much discussed focus issues). It costs a lot to stay at the top of the food chain and not everyone can drop $4k & $7k respectively every couple of years to have the latest in sensor technology. The mid range bodies have improved greatly especially in the last year or so. I decided to take another approach. I sold my 1Ds2 to buy a 5D2, so far very happy. I am ready to sell 1D2n in anticipation of the 7D. Because the camera is also the film I believe it's critical to image quality to stay on the leading edge of the technology. If you don't require the robust build of the 1 series bodies, the mid range bodies have finally arrived and offer a lot more bang for the buck. If/when DPRevew gives it a thumbs up, I'm in.

    I picked up the camera today. I really like it. I think if this had been released before the 5Dmk2, I would have kept my original 5D. I don't print landscape stuff large enough to justify 21mp, and the video on the 7D is much better(options, not quality) than on the 5Dmk2. Oh well, the 5Dmk2 still rocks, and certain things like Live View make some shots a lot easier.
